Record
by Morgan B Merriweather

Wednesday, May 01, 2013
Rated "G" by the Author.
Share   Print  Save   Become a Fan


 

 

 

 

 

 

The wall, listing in green chalcedony mortar of gold.

Years, run up through the gauntlet. Marked passage, days down, owned.

Chain dangles, sways to the symbolism.  Chance. Yours/mine

Key for the locket, the line on the line to heaven’s door
